(3,5,5,6,8,8-Hexamethyl-5,6,7,8-tetrahydronaphthalen-2-yl)methanol: a possible metabolite of the synthetic musk fragrance AHTN

R. Faust, D. Nauroozi, C. Bruhn, B. Koch, P. Kuhlich, C. Piechotta and I. Nehls

Abstract: The title compound (AHTN-OH), C17H26O, was prepared in order to provide standard materials for the qualitative and quantitative analysis of environmental pollutants. The molecule possesses a chiral C atom, although the structure determination was performed on racemic material, expressed in the structure as disordered chiral sites. The asymmetric unit consists of four AHTN-OH molecules containing an hydroxy group and forming a tetrameric cyclic motif built up by four strong hydrogen bonds between these hydroxy groups and additionally by two weak C-H...[pi] interactions. Furthermore, these tetramers are linked via very weak C-H...[pi] interactions, forming chains along the c axis.
